Types of Premium Packaging Solutions

Industrial packaging solutions are available in various materials and designs to meet diverse business needs. Cardboard, for instance, is widely used due to its versatility and ease of customisation. It is ideal for products that require sturdy yet lightweight packaging. Plastic, known for its durability and flexibility, is often used for packaging that needs to withstand rough handling and protect against moisture. Though more expensive, metal packaging offers superior protection and is used for items that require high security and durability. Wood is another popular option, especially for heavy or fragile goods, as it provides robust support and cushioning.

Some industries have specific packaging requirements. The food industry, for example, often uses vacuum-sealed packaging to maintain freshness and prevent contamination. Electronics require anti-static packaging to protect delicate components from electrostatic discharge. Additionally, pharmaceuticals may need tamper-evident seals to ensure product safety and integrity.

Customisation is a key aspect of premium packaging. Tailoring the design, size, and material to the specific product not only enhances protection but also improves brand presentation. Advanced printing techniques can add logos, product information, and other branding elements, making the packaging functional and visually appealing.

How Industrial Packaging Enhances Efficiency in Logistics Storage

Industrial packaging plays a vital role in optimising logistics and storage operations. Efficient packaging solutions are designed to maximise space utilisation, allowing more products to be stored and transported in a given area. This reduces storage costs and enhances transportation efficiency by minimising the number of trips required.

Durable and well-designed packaging ensures that products are protected from damage during transit, reducing the risk of returns and losses. Packaging that is easy to handle and stackable can significantly streamline warehouse operations, making the loading and unloading processes faster and more efficient. This leads to improved productivity and reduced labour costs.

Additionally, clear labelling and barcoding on packaging can facilitate better inventory management. These features allow for quick identification and tracking of products, essential for maintaining accurate inventory records and ensuring timely deliveries.

Innovative packaging technologies like smart sensors can further enhance logistics efficiency. These sensors can monitor the condition of the products in real-time, providing valuable data that can be used to improve handling and storage practices.

By integrating these advanced packaging solutions, businesses can achieve greater operational efficiency, reduce waste, and improve overall supply chain performance. This ultimately leads to cost savings and better service delivery to customers.

Sustainable Eco-Friendly Packaging Alternatives

Businesses today are increasingly adopting eco-friendly packaging alternatives to address environmental concerns and meet consumer expectations. Compostable packaging is gaining popularity, made from materials that break down naturally without harming the environment. Plant-based plastics, derived from renewable resources like cornstarch or sugarcane, offer a biodegradable option that reduces reliance on petroleum-based plastics. Minimalistic designs, which use fewer materials without compromising protection, are also embraced to minimise waste.

Reusable packaging is another effective solution, providing longevity and reducing the need for single-use materials. This can include containers that can be returned, cleaned, and reused, promoting a circular economy. Additionally, recycled materials are used more frequently, turning waste products into new packaging solutions and reducing the need for virgin resources.

Innovative technologies are crucial in advancing sustainable packaging. For example, water-soluble films are emerging as an eco-friendly option for packaging detergents and other household goods. Though still in its early stages, edible packaging presents a fascinating opportunity for reducing waste in the food industry.

Businesses also focus on sourcing materials from certified sustainable sources, collaborating with suppliers, and prioritising eco-friendly practices. By adopting these alternatives, companies can significantly reduce their environmental footprint and align with global sustainability goals.
